相关文章
基于云原生网关的流量防护实践
作者:涂鸦
背景
在分布式系统架构中,每个请求都会经过很多层处理,比如从入口网关再到 Web Server 再到服务之间的调用,再到服务访问缓存或 DB 等存储。在下图流量防护体系中,我们通常遵循流量漏斗原则进行流量防护。…
编程日记
2024/12/15 2:02:12
Python Flask token身份认证
首先安装依赖:
pip install flask-jwt-extended
然后在主应用中(项目入口文件)加入以下代码:
from flask import Flask
from flask_jwt_extended import JWTManager #引入依赖
app Flask(__name__)
app.config[JWT_SECRET_KEY…
编程日记
2024/12/20 9:20:24
【Spring Boot】以博客管理系统举例,完整表述SpringBoot从对接Vue到数据库的流程与结构。
博客管理系统是一个典型的前后端分离的应用,其中前端使用Vue框架进行开发,后端使用Spring Boot框架进行开发,数据库使用MySQL进行存储。下面是从对接Vue到数据库的完整流程和结构。
对接Vue
在前端Vue应用中,需要访问后端Spring…
编程日记
2024/12/23 23:14:54
Linux安装NVM(简洁版)
安装目录 mkdir /opt/nvm && cd /opt/nvm 安装包下载 wget https://github.com/nvm-sh/nvm/archive/refs/tags/v0.39.5.tar.gz
注意:https://github.com/nvm-sh/nvm/tags获取下载链接并替换 安装包解压 for file in *.tar.gz; do tar -zxvf "$file&quo…
编程日记
2024/12/23 5:34:07
LVS+Keepalived群集
目录
keepalived 概述
keepalived 体系主要模块及其作用
keepalived 工作原理
一个健康的集群的特点
Keepalived经常会出现的问题
脑裂现象
出现脑裂现象产生的原因
怎么预防脑裂现象
keepalived的配置相关解释
部署keepalived
部署192.168.142.20
部署192.168.142…
编程日记
2024/12/23 22:37:44
【Android-Flutter】我的Flutter开发之旅
目录: 0、文档:1、在Windows上搭建Flutter开发环境(1)[使用中国镜像(❌详细看官方文档)](https://docs.flutter.dev/community/china)(2)[下载最新版Flutter SDK(已包含Dart)](https://docs.flu…
编程日记
2024/12/22 19:17:38
Postman API测试之道:不止于点击,更在于策略
引言:API测试的重要性
在当今的软件开发中,API已经成为了一个不可或缺的部分。它们是软件组件之间交互的桥梁,确保数据的流动和功能的实现。因此,对API的测试显得尤为重要,它不仅关乎功能的正确性,还涉及到…
编程日记
2024/12/17 20:41:01